Signage in the Workplace 

Workplace signage refers to signs that are used in a workplace setting which are typically used to convey important messages, instructions, warnings or guidelines to employees, visitors or anyone present in the workplace. Workplace signs serve multiple purposes including promoting safety, providing directions, conveying regulatory information and supporting overall organizational communication.

There are different types of workplace signage, each serving a specific purpose. Some common categories include:

  • Safety Signs: These signs are crucial for promoting a safe work environment. They include warnings about potential hazards, emergency exit signs, first aid signs and instructions on the use of safety equipment.
  • Informational Signs: These signs provide information about specific areas, facilities, or processes within the workplace. Examples include signs indicating restrooms, meeting rooms, break areas or designated work zones.
  • Regulatory Signs: These signs communicate compliance with laws and regulations. They may include signs indicating the use of personal protective equipment (PPE), no smoking areas or other regulatory requirements.
  • Directional Signs: These signs help individuals navigate through the workplace by providing directions to specific locations, such as offices, conference rooms or emergency exits.
  • Identification Signs: These signs help identify specific areas, equipment or items within the workplace. Examples include room numbers, equipment labels, or storage area signs.

The design and placement of workplace signage are essential to ensure that the information is easily visible, understandable, and aligns with safety and regulatory standards. Effective workplace signage contributes to a safer and more organized work environment by reducing the risk of accidents, enhancing communication, and facilitating smooth navigation within the facility.

Workplace Safety Signs in Australia 

Workplace safety signage plays a crucial role in promoting a safe and healthy work environment. They use recognisable workplace safety signs and symbols, colors and text to convey important information about potential hazards, safety procedures, and emergency exits. The use of standardized symbols and colors helps ensure that the messages are universally understood, regardless of language barriers.
